What Happened At The Previous Episode?

( Credit: GoHands )

In the previous episode of “The Girl I Like Forgot Her Glasses,” the storyline revolved around the deepening friendship between Komura and Mie. A year had passed since Komura accidentally fell into Mie’s life during a moment when she wasn’t wearing her glasses, setting the stage for the ongoing narrative. As a new semester began, viewers were filled with anticipation, wondering whether the two friends would be separated due to new seating arrangements or if new deskmates would enter the picture.

Throughout the episode, viewers witnessed moments of intimacy and budding romance between Komura and Mie. One particularly heartwarming scene featured Komura taking Mie’s forgotten glasses home to ensure their safety, leading to endearing encounters between the two. Their journey toward a closer bond continued through various interactions, including attending a confession together.

As their connection grew stronger, the two faced a decision regarding a school field trip – whether to join the group or venture out separately. Mie’s reliance on her glasses added an element of unpredictability to their escapades, but Komura was always there to assist and ensure her safety.

The episode left viewers pondering the future of Mie and Komura’s relationship as they grew “much, much closer.” This enigmatic line hinted at a unique request that Mie had made to Komura, setting the stage for further developments in their evolving friendship.
